    Poker is such a great example to explain what metagaming is. Cause poker is all about knowing your opponent, their leaks and tendencies and try to exploit them. Good players will always do research and scout their opponents to see if they are legit players or not and they use to tag opponents and write down notes on them. All this is to use information outside the current game to help them with their decisions. Literally the definition of metagaming imo. Great video!

    Not really--like you said, when most people are talking about the metagame of whatever it may be, it's probably assumed that it's the more popular strategies that are used is being discussed. Since most people aren't going to use or even really discuss an inefficient, unorthodox, or bad strategy (unless it's some sort of random cheese/hail mary play). But technically, I'd probably stand to the definition that the Metagame is the all-encompassing advanced strategies used that aren't necessarily implied or tutorialized in the game/gameplay. They just develop over time as the game ages. It's just some are obviously better and more flexible than others, while some Meta-play could be very situational; like a cheese/hail mary. Weird example, but in Chess Openings; 20+ years ago, I probably would've said that a Reti or Sicilian opening was the best option for the first move for white, since they're the most flexible and allows for more open-ended choices in the mid and end-game. How it is now, I'm not sure... I've haven't competed in a while. But since so many strategies have played out and have been analyzed to such an absurd extent; it may just be better to attempt more unorthodox strategies that may confuse your opponent, since they wouldn't be expecting it.     Great vid. Metafiction is self-referential fiction by definition. Whenever a video game refers to itself as a piece of (interactive) fiction, it falls under this category. Because video games are also games, however, and strategy is involved, the other use of meta relevant to strategy is also valid. Whether it be the boundaries of storytelling or stated mechanics in developing new strategies, both usages comply to the original philosophical meaning of "meta," which means to go beyond.

    No, it's just tactics and strategy at a higher level. But things that aren't necessarily explained as strategy in-game or assumed as strats. Like reading a person's personality in Poker; knowing/utilizing the tier list to LOL or Overwatch.; or, devising strategies in competitive Starcraft or Chess. But since most people would normally use the most effective strats, it would make sense to assume; but in the case of cheese/spam/Hail Mary tactics, they're not necessarily the best, but work under certain circumstances. But once a person really knows the ins and outs of a game, they would more or less know when it's best to utilize a sub-optimal option.     meta = sth on a higher lvl than the original object when it comes to dimensions (the higher lvl includes the lower lvl). Metatext = text that is about a text. Second metatext = text that is about the first metatext etc. Metagame = 1. the parts outside the actual game (e.g. an UI where u can build a deck 4 battle). 2. Thinking what your opponent is thinking. (the 1st metagame) Thinking what ur opponent is thinking u're thinking is the 2nd metagame, thinking what the opponent is thinking u're thinking that s/he's thinking is the 3rd metagame etc. 3. Having some information about the game u can't rly know. E.g. after playing enough CS u may know where the enemy is coming from even though ur character hasn't seen him/her.
